England are set to play two out of their three Super 8 matches at the Pallekele International Cricket Sta ...
England are set to play two out of their three Super 8 matches at the Pallekele International Cricket Stadium in Kandy. The other one will be played at the R. Premadasa Stadium in Colombo.In the group ...